We call your attention to section 1.1 and 1.3: The Accessibility Maturity Model has been developed using research of existing maturity models and standards outside of WCAG. For example, 15:54:55 ISO/IEC 30071-1:2019 Information Technology - Development Of User Interface Accessibility - Part 1: Code Of Practice For Creating Accessible ICT Products And Services 15:54:55 This ISO standard includes specifics to the incorporation of accessibility practices into the design and development process. This is orthogonal to the Accessibility Maturity Model which provides a way to assess an organization's accessibility maturity in dimensions beyond the design and development process. Adherence to ISO 30071-1:2019 could be 15:54:55 used as a [proof point](https://w3c.github.io/maturity-model/#dfn-proof-point) for the maturity of the ICT Development Lifecycle dimension. 15:54:57 Please, let us know if you agree and we can close this issue? 15:56:55 Resolution: closing issue with proposed response 15:57:15 zakim, end meeting 15:57:15 As of this point the attendees have been Dr_Keith, stacey, Mark_Miller, AngelaBarker, jkline, SusiPallero, JXZ 15:57:17 RRSAgent, please draft minutes 15:57:18 I have made the request to generate https://www.w3.org/2024/08/28-maturity-minutes.html Zakim 15:57:25 I am happy to have been of service, JXZ; please remember to excuse RRSAgent.
